Jacaranda trees are really lovely and it makes Sydney look quite different. The best lane to photograph jacaranda trees in Sydney is in Milsons Point. Of course, Grafton, New South Wales – a town around 7-hr drive north of Sydney – has the most Jacaranda trees that looks surreal.
